But since __GFP_KILLABLE does not exist, > SIGKILL is pending does not imply that current thread will make progress by > leaving the retry loop immediately. Therefore, Although this is true I do not think that cluttering the code with this case is anyhow useful. In the vast majority of cases SIGKILL pending will be a result of the oom killer.
